Move or Hide Quick Play Bar?

Does anyone know how to move or hide the Quick Play bar? Somehow it has appeared on the bottom of the broadcast screen and is overwriting part of the pitcher and batter cards, making it impossible to see the pitch count. I have played quite a few games and for some reason it started appearing today.

In another thread someone suggested File > Settings > Icon Bar set to "Show Right". Mine is set to "Show Right" (see screenshot).

He posted a screen shot in his first post. The bar he is talking about is the one that has the quick play options on it. I don't know of any way to move this bar. What he can do is use the red box in the top right that is labeled "configure screen" and either move some boxes around or change the size of the boxes.

It looks like he is playing on a laptop and has limited screen resolution and/or screen space.
